Residual moisture evaporation
After the third rinse, the residual
moisture evaporation process will
begin.
Remove the container and tube from
the oven.
Close the door.
Confirm with OK.
Risk of injury caused by steam.
Steam can cause severe scalding.
Do not open the door while the
residual water is being evaporated.
The oven heating will turn on and the
duration of the evaporation process will
count down on the display.
During the evaporation process, the
duration may be adjusted by the system
according to how much water is
currently present.
Finishing the descaling process
At the end of residual moisture
evaporation process, an information
window will appear with tips on
cleaning after the descaling process.
Confirm with OK.
An audible signal will sound and Ready
will appear.
Select Close.
Turn the oven off with the On/Off
button.
Risk of injury caused by hot
surfaces.
The oven gets hot during operation.
You could burn yourself on the
heating elements, oven
compartment, or accessories.
Allow the heating elements, oven
compartment, and accessories to
cool before manual cleaning.
Remove the universal tray with the
collected fluid and empty it.
When the oven compartment has
cooled down, clean away any
condensation and descaling agent
residues.
Leave the oven door open until the
oven compartment is completely dry.
